Here are just a few tips and tricks that I have learned along the way. Also, think about rolling your shoulders down and together on your back any time you can. Good posture allows the neck to be in its ideal, least stressed position. Finally, think about tucking your chin closer to your neck. Many of us jut our chin forward causing a forward head posture. We are constantly looking forward and down: another unnatural position for the neck that can cause strain.  Walk tall, do yoga, and take care of your cervical spine!
